TPWallet创建过程全景解析,并结合“公钥加密—合约验证—市场未来报告—全球化创新发展”的逻辑链条,最终落到“安全可靠性高、效率高”的高效数字系统目标。
一、TPWallet创建过程:从零到可用的完整链路
1)准备与身份建立
- 进入应用/网页端后,通常会选择“创建钱包(Create)”。系统需要你确认用途与网络环境(如主网/测试网),并告知备份与风控规则。
- 生成助记词(seed phrase)或直接生成密钥材料。助记词是恢复钱包的关键凭证,等价于能推导出公私钥的“根种子”。
- 创建完成后通常会要求:
a) 备份助记词(离线抄写/备份);
b) 二次校验(按顺序选择助记词词条)。
2)密钥派生与地址生成
- 在助记词确立后,钱包会基于标准路径(例如 BIP 39/44/32 的思路,具体实现依链而定)派生出私钥与对应公钥。
- 由公钥进一步生成地址(Address)。地址是链上可识别的标识,公开传播不会直接泄露私钥。
3)公钥加密在创建环节的核心作用
公钥加密(Public-Key Cryptography)用于实现“可公开验证、不可伪造签名”两个目标。
- 私钥用于签名:当你进行转账、授权(如给合约批准代币)或消息确认时,钱包会用私钥对交易/请求进行签名。
- 公钥用于验证:网络节点或合约可验证签名是否对应该公钥/地址。
- 典型效果:

a) 任何人都能验证“签名有效性”;
b) 但只有持有私钥的人才能产生有效签名;
c) 这使得钱包在不暴露私钥的情况下仍能完成可信授权。
4)与链交互前的“初始化校验”
- 钱包创建完成后,通常需要进行链连接校验:确认 RPC/节点可用、链 ID(Chain ID)一致、基本交易参数正确。
- 同时进行余额/资产同步:通过地址查询余额、代币列表、合约事件索引等方式完成展示。
二、合约验证:把“链上权限”做得更可控
合约验证(Contract Verification)并不止是“能不能部署”,而是对合约代码与调用行为的可信度做约束。对用户而言尤其关键,因为钱包往往会发起对合约的调用与授权。
1)合约源代码验证(可读与可审计)
- 在主流链上,项目常将合约源代码上传并验证,使得用户能通过区块浏览器查看:

a) 合约的代码是否与已部署字节码一致;
b) 是否存在可疑的后门逻辑或权限滥用风险。
- 对钱包来说,合约验证提供了“透明性基础”,让用户能在签名前做判断。
2)调用参数与权限的验证
- 合约验证不仅是“代码真不真”,还要关心“你要签的东西是不是你以为的那样”。
- 钱包侧通常会做:
a) 函数名与参数解码(让用户看到将调用的具体方法);
b) 金额/代币地址匹配校验(减少“授权给错误地址”等风险);
c) 额度范围提示(例如无限授权的风险提示)。
3)交易层的链上可验证性
- 因为交易签名基于私钥,链上能验证“这笔交易确实由该地址发起”。
- 在合约层,EVM/VM 运行会产生确定性结果,便于追踪与审计。
三、市场未来报告:钱包从“工具”走向“基础设施”
从市场趋势看,TPWallet类产品的未来更像“数字身份入口 + 多链资产管理 + 交易/授权安全网”。
1)用户需求变化
- 从简单转账到:DeFi交互、跨链资产、授权管理、链上身份(Profile/Claim)、支付/订阅等。
- 用户开始更关注:
a) 授权安全(避免资金被动挪用);
b) 交易可读性(签名前看到清晰信息);
c) 风险提示(钓鱼合约、恶意DApp识别)。
2)竞争焦点从功能走向“系统可靠性”
- 市场会进一步压缩“低成本功能”,把竞争转移到:
a) 合约调用的安全解析能力;
b) 多链兼容的稳定性;
c) 反欺诈与防误签策略;
d) 性能与用户体验(速度、失败重试、网络容错)。
3)监管与合规可能带来的技术升级
- 未来更强调“可追踪与可证明”的链上能力:透明合约、清晰权限边界、可验证的交互记录。
- 钱包产品会更重视:
a) 风险行为的可解释;
b) 用户教育与弹窗提示的精细化。
四、全球化创新发展:多链、多地区、多生态的协同
全球化创新发展意味着钱包不仅“在某条链上可用”,而要做到:
1)多链资产与跨生态兼容
- 不同链的地址格式、签名机制、Gas模型、合约标准不同。
- 全球化会推动钱包在架构上形成“统一抽象层”:
a) 资产管理层(Token/Balance/Portfolio);
b) 交易编排层(签名、广播、重试、确认);
c) 合约交互层(函数解码、权限识别)。
2)面向不同地区的安全与体验适配
- 网络环境差异(延迟、节点稳定性)会影响交易体验。
- 语言与文化差异会影响“用户理解签名内容”的能力。
- 因此,钱包需要更强的本地化与风险教育机制。
3)生态协作与标准化
- 生态越开放,越需要标准:合约接口命名、授权流程统一呈现、风险信息格式化。
- 通过标准化提升“可读性”,让全球用户更容易建立信任。
五、安全可靠性高:从密钥到交互的分层防护
要实现“安全可靠性高”,TPWallet类系统可采用分层策略:
1)密钥安全(Key Management)
- 创建时不应暴露私钥;私钥只在本地生成和使用。
- 助记词离线备份策略、设备安全(如应用锁/生物识别)能降低物理层风险。
2)交易安全(Transaction Safety)
- 交易解码与提示:把用户签名的内容“人类可读”。
- 风险检测:
a) 可疑合约地址或已知钓鱼特征;
b) 授权过大(无限授权)提醒;
c) 确认金额、收款地址、链 ID 的一致性。
3)合约与权限安全(Contract & Permission Safety)
- 对合约进行代码验证/来源可信提示。
- 对常见风险授权(例如授权给不明合约)做策略性限制或更强提示。
4)系统可靠性(System Reliability)
- RPC容错、重试策略、广播与确认的状态机设计,避免“卡住/重复提交”。
- 本地缓存与一致性策略,确保余额展示、交易状态更新准确。
六、高效数字系统:性能、可用性与成本的平衡
“高效数字系统”体现在:
1)快速响应与低延迟交互
- 交易签名在本地完成,避免把关键数据泄露到外部。
- 广播、确认与索引采用异步管道,减少等待。
2)资源与成本优化
- 多链下对网络选择、节点负载均衡、费用估算进行优化。
- 通过批量查询、缓存与增量更新降低带宽与查询成本。
3)用户流程效率
- 创建、备份、校验、导入恢复应尽量减少摩擦。
- 对风险动作提供明确的“下一步原因”,让用户用更少的时间做更准确的决策。
结语
TPWallet创建过程可被理解为一条从“公钥加密的可信签名”到“合约验证的可审计交互”,再到“市场未来的系统化需求”和“全球化创新带来的标准化协同”,最终在工程实现上追求“安全可靠性高、效率高”的高效数字系统路线。随着多链生态扩大,用户对签名可读性、授权安全、合约可信度与系统稳定性的期待只会更高;因此,钱包产品的核心竞争力将持续从“能用”走向“更可信、更可控、更高性能”。
评论
MiaWen
把公钥加密和合约验证串起来讲得很清晰,尤其是“签名前可读性”的重点很到位。
链影Echo
全球化创新那段写得像路线图:多链抽象层+标准化呈现,确实会影响体验和安全。
NoahK
安全可靠性高不只是技术,还包括交易状态机、RPC容错这些工程细节,文中提到的很实用。
小南风
市场未来报告部分的判断比较贴近趋势:从功能竞争转向系统可靠性与风控。
AstraLiu
高效数字系统讲到缓存和增量更新,这种“看不见的效率”才是钱包体验的关键。